Output 4265e84e14ddc73067b9684f2617a818323b450bea67f0f3a58466a9dc6d12f9:1

value
2598805
script pubkey
OP_0 OP_PUSHBYTES_20 e689b890931563aebfd3a3d3a17bc1fba3841b48
address
ltc1qu6ym3yynz436a07n50f6z77plw3cgx6g7ccvsa
transaction
4265e84e14ddc73067b9684f2617a818323b450bea67f0f3a58466a9dc6d12f9
spent
true